Get a QuoteSteam Calculators: Boiler Calculator. Steam, Boiler, and Blowdown Pressure are the same. Combustion Efficiency is the % of fuel energy that is directly added to the feedwater and not otherwise lost or used. Get a Quote2020-10-9 · Steam flow rate when kW rating is known can be calculated as. m s = 3600 P / h e (1). where. m s = steam flow rate (kg/h). P = load in kW (kW) h e = specific enthalpy of evaporation of steam at working pressure (kJ/kg)

Get a Quote2015-7-29 · ∗Saturated steam: Temperature and pressure are dependent variables. Density can be calculated by measuring one variable. ∗Superheated steam: Temperature and pressure are independent variables. You must measure both to calculate density to measure mass flow and energy. Density
